titleOfInvention Method for processing color photosensitive silver halide material
abstract PURPOSE: To improve remarkably the stability of an image by processing a photosensitive material with a color developing soln. contg. a compound represented by a specified general formula. n CONSTITUTION: A color photosensitive silver halide material is processed with a color developing soln. contg. at least one kind of compound represented by formula I , wherein X is H, an alkali metallic atom, an ammonium ion, alkyl or aryl, Y is halogen, alkyl, alkoxy, amino, hydroxyl, nitro, sulfonic acid or carboxylic acid, and n is 0, 1, 2, 3 or 4. A compound in which n is 0 and X is optionally substituted alkyl or phenyl or a compound in which n is 1 or 2 and Y is sulfonic acid, nitro, carboxylic acid, halogen, preferably chlorine, optionally substituted amino or hydroxyl, e.g., a compound represented by formula II or III is preferably used. Aromatic primary amine is widely used as a color developing agent, and the preferred amine is an o-phenylenediamine deriv. n COPYRIGHT: (C)1984,JPO&Japio
